UPDATE 2 (May 11, 2011):
Off the main page
"Get ready He-Fans and She-Ravers!
Power-Con will take place Saturday, September 24th and Sunday, September 25th at the Four Points at the Los Angeles Intl Airport! You can fly directly into LAX, jump on the free hotel shuttle and be there in no time!
Show hours are from 10am to 6pm on Saturday followed by a limited attendance dinner (details coming soon) and then an after-hours mixer open to everyone
and from 10am to 5pm on Sunday.

The Voices of She-Ra and Skeletor Coming to Power-Con!
Melendy Britt, the voice of She-Ra: Princess of Power, and Alan Oppenheimer, the voice of Skeletor, will be appearing at the convention only on Sunday, September 25.
Ms. Britt and Mr. Oppenheimer will be participating in two events on Sunday: a General Admission Panel and a Ticketed Autograph Signing Session.
